  • i got my surgery done about 2 weeks ago as well and i just got my splint out today, I was wondering if your teeth fit together properly?, because after i got my splint out i realized that my teeth do not occlude at all. Even though the ortho said this is normal and will be fixed I feel like i have an open bite in the back of my mouth where my molars are.

  • First of all, congrats on the surgery. Second, I never had a splint in my mouth so I'm not sure how that works but I can tell you my molars feel like they fit together o.k. when my mouth is closed. There is a small overbite in the front but I've been told by my surgeon that is normal and my orthodontist will perfect things. I hope everything is sorted out with your bite- I'm sure you'll feel better soon.

  • Sometimes it's hard for the orthodontist to get the molars properly aligned because of the pressure of the uneven bite (you had before). I'm sure they'll have a much easier time getting your teeth in place now that your bite is correct : )

  • Yeah i also have about a 2 mm overbite right now its a little bit more apparent than your I think too. Also i don't think my bite is as bad as i thought before. I think apart of it has to do with the muscle atrophy in my jaw from not using it the past couple of week. My surgeon removed almost an inch of bone from my bottom jaw to move it back 9 or 10 mm because of how angular my jaw was. Its really crazy how different i look, but im glad i did it, and once my bite comes together its gonna be fun
